I have a piggy that's bedded on fleece, and just yesterday after putting a new piece of fleece down, my piggy keeps crawling underneath the bedding. I put newspaper on the bottom layer, then a thick towel, and then fleece. I then tape the corners down to keep the fleece in place. However my piggy keeps crawling underneath the fleece. I added more tape so she won't be able to do it, but she still manages to sqeeze in there by pulling the tape off. >:( Has anyone ever had this problem? If so how do you keep your piggy from hiding in the fleece? or if anyone has any idea how to secure the fleece please let me know. Thanks!

do you put plenty of hay on top of the fleece?

guinea pigs love burrowing under hay, if you're not using any or not enough hay then they will try to burrow under the fleece.

do you have any other little hide-aways in the hutch/cage? things like an igloo or wooden 'house'.
 
mine always burrow under the towels etc but have found if you put an upside down cuddle cup they love it, jnx is like a tortoise he will walk about with it on his back, dobby likes to sit in it, sometimes I add a small towel or t towel in the cup to snuggle under
